auth_opts = [
cfg.StrOpt("auth_strategy",
default="keystone",
choices=("keystone", "noauth2"),
deprecated_group="default",
help="""
default="keystone",
choices=("keystone", "noauth2"),
deprecated_group="default",
help="""
This determines the strategy to use for authentication: keystone or noauth2.
'noauth2' is designed for testing only, as it does no actual credential
checking. 'noauth2' provides administrative credentials only if 'admin' is
specified as the username.
"""),
